Episode 61! And this week the hosts, Deenie, Sarah and Dan are discussing some of the content and themes from UKREiiF and all the shared living news from the last couple of weeks including:

- The highs and lows of UKREiiF

- Is PBSA less sexy than BTR and coliving?

- Is the night time economy considered when designing spaces?

- Will the UK see a bounce from international students rejecting (and being rejected by) the USA?
